Merge pull request #5 from QuasarApp/JDK17
Some checks failed
buildbot/DocsGenerator Build finished.
buildbot/WindowsCMakeBuilder Build finished.
buildbot/IOSCMakeBuilder Build finished.
buildbot/AndroidBuilder_v8Qt6 Build finished.
buildbot/LinuxCMakeBuilderQt6 Build finished.

JDK 17
This commit is contained in:
Andrei Yankovich 2023-09-07 15:34:31 +03:00 committed by GitHub
commit f04966fc03
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
2 changed files with 7 additions and 7 deletions

View File

@ -10,7 +10,7 @@ fi
OLD_SDK_ROOT=$HOME/AndroidSDK OLD_SDK_ROOT=$HOME/AndroidSDK
SDK_ROOT=$EXTERNAL_HOME/AndroidSDK SDK_ROOT=$EXTERNAL_HOME/AndroidSDK
export JAVA_HOME="$SNAP/usr/lib/jvm/java-11-openjdk-amd64" export JAVA_HOME="$SNAP/usr/lib/jvm/java-17-openjdk-amd64"
export ANDROID_SDK_HOME="$HOME/.Android" export ANDROID_SDK_HOME="$HOME/.Android"
export _JAVA_OPTIONS=-Duser.home=$HOME export _JAVA_OPTIONS=-Duser.home=$HOME

View File

@ -1,5 +1,5 @@
name: androidsdk name: androidsdk
version: '1.2.0.1' version: '1.2.1.1'
summary: The package contains android sdkmanager. summary: The package contains android sdkmanager.
description: | description: |
This is snap version of console sdk manager for Android. For more information about sdkmanager see official google documentation git@github.com:EndrII/sdkmanager-android.git. This is snap version of console sdk manager for Android. For more information about sdkmanager see official google documentation git@github.com:EndrII/sdkmanager-android.git.
@ -18,19 +18,19 @@ parts:
stage-packages: stage-packages:
- libfreetype6 - libfreetype6
- libpng16-16 - libpng16-16
- openjdk-11-jdk - openjdk-17-jdk
- openjdk-11-jre - openjdk-17-jre
- openjdk-11-jre-headless - openjdk-17-jre-headless
build-packages: build-packages:
- ca-certificates - ca-certificates
- ca-certificates-java - ca-certificates-java
- openjdk-11-jre-headless - openjdk-17-jre-headless
override-stage: | override-stage: |
snapcraftctl stage snapcraftctl stage
chmod 777 -R "$SNAPCRAFT_STAGE/cmdline-tools" chmod 777 -R "$SNAPCRAFT_STAGE/cmdline-tools"
override-prime: | override-prime: |
snapcraftctl prime snapcraftctl prime
rm -vf usr/lib/jvm/java-11-openjdk-*/lib/security/blacklisted.certs rm -vf usr/lib/jvm/java-17-openjdk-*/lib/security/blacklisted.certs
after: after:
- androidsdk-wraper - androidsdk-wraper